South Dakota School of Mines - 1897

All faculty, except one, resign due to low salaries [Fifth Biennial Report of the Regents of Education of the State of South Dakota To The Governor For The Fiscal Years 1897 and 1898, Ending June 30, 1898: Transmitted to the Legislature at the Fifth Biennial Session, 1899. 1898, pg. 20]

November - Dean McGillycuddy resigns [Fifth Biennial Report of the Regents of Education of the State of South Dakota To The Governor For The Fiscal Years 1897 and 1898, Ending June 30, 1898: Transmitted to the Legislature at the Fifth Biennial Session, 1899. 1898, pg. 21, 75]

Regents recommend salary increases at School of Mines to "retain competent and efficient men as instructors" [Fifth Biennial Report of the Regents of Education of the State of South Dakota To The Governor For The Fiscal Years 1897 and 1898, Ending June 30, 1898: Transmitted to the Legislature at the Fifth Biennial Session, 1899. 1898, pg. 22]
